Skip to content

Supabase Review

Supabase is the Postgres development platform, building Firebase features using enterprise-grade open-source tools.

shipped May 27, 2026automatefreemium
Supabase - AI tool
1Supabase is an open-source Firebase alternative built on Postgres, offering a comprehensive backend suite.
2It provides database, authentication, storage, edge functions, real-time capabilities, and pgvector for embeddings.
3The platform is ISO/IEC 27001:2022 certified and SOC2 Type 2 compliant, with HIPAA alignment for Team and Enterprise plans.
4Daily backups are retained for 7 days on Pro plans, 14 days on Team plans, and up to 30 days on Enterprise plans.

Stork Quadrant

Becomes the API· 57/100

Replaceable as a UI, but kept alive as the API the agents call.

Confidencehigh(3 runs · ±0)

Supabase is infrastructure, not a UI — and infrastructure compounds. The LLM can write the SQL, but it can't run the Postgres instance, manage the auth tokens, store the files, or fire the realtime events. The MCP server is a smart move: it makes Supabase the backend agents call, not the thing agents replace. Brand is real — developers trust it, fork it, and build on it publicly.

Claude Sonnet 4.6, scored 2026-05-27

Defensibility · 34/100

  • Physical-world coupling
  • Regulatory moat
  • Network liquidity
  • Proprietary refreshing data
  • High-trust catastrophic workflows
  • Multi-party coordination
  • Brand / community / taste

An LLM alone could replace

  • Write SQL queries or schema migrations for a Postgres database
  • Generate auth logic, JWT handling, or RLS policy definitions
  • Draft edge function code in TypeScript/Deno
  • Explain pgvector embedding strategies or write vector search queries

Agent-Readiness · 85/100

  • Verified MCPStork MCP listing: supabase-mcp-2 (confirmed)
  • Listed on agent surfacesanthropic_directory, cursor + Stork:supabase-mcp-2
  • Usage-based pricingpricing page heuristic match: https://supabase.com/pricing
  • Headless agent auth
  • Public OpenAPIhttps://docs.supabase.com/openapi.json
  • Active changeloghttps://supabase.com/changelog (2026-05-18)
  • llms.txthttps://supabase.com/llms.txt

Score history · +11 pts over 2 re-scores

How to defend

Double down on the MCP server as the agent-native interface and own the 'backend for AI apps' positioning hard — pgvector plus auth plus realtime is a bundle no LLM alone can replicate.

  • Expose API-key auth with a self-serve sandbox tier; remove sales-call gates (+15).

Supabase at a Glance

Best For
automate, platform
Pricing
freemium
Key Features
automate, platform
Integrations
See website
Alternatives
See comparison section

Similar Tools

Compare Alternatives

Other tools you might consider

</>Embed "Featured on Stork" Badge
Badge previewBadge preview light
<a href="https://www.stork.ai/en/supabase" target="_blank" rel="noopener noreferrer"><img src="https://www.stork.ai/api/badge/supabase?style=dark" alt="Supabase - Featured on Stork.ai" height="36" /></a>
[![Supabase - Featured on Stork.ai](https://www.stork.ai/api/badge/supabase?style=dark)](https://www.stork.ai/en/supabase)

overview

What is Supabase?

Supabase is a backend-as-a-service (BaaS) platform developed by Supabase that enables developers, startups, and companies to build web, mobile, and AI applications rapidly. It provides a comprehensive suite of open-source tools including a PostgreSQL database, authentication, file storage, and real-time capabilities. Positioned as an open-source alternative to Firebase, Supabase leverages enterprise-grade open-source technologies to offer a fully managed PostgreSQL database, instant APIs, and serverless Edge Functions. The platform integrates pgvector for storing and querying high-dimensional vector data, making it suitable for modern AI and machine learning applications. Supabase maintains a strong commitment to data security and privacy, evidenced by its ISO/IEC 27001:2022 certification and SOC2 Type 2 compliance, and explicitly states it never trains on user data.

quick facts

Quick Facts

AttributeValue
DeveloperSupabase
Business ModelFreemium
PricingFreemium with paid tiers starting from $25/month
PlatformsWeb, Mobile, API
API AvailableYes
IntegrationsPostgreSQL, Deno, pgvector, Stripe Marketplace
ComplianceISO/IEC 27001:2022, SOC2 Type 2, HIPAA aligned
Data TrainingNever trains on user data

features

Key Features of Supabase

Supabase provides a robust set of backend services designed to accelerate application development, all built around a PostgreSQL database.

  • 1**PostgreSQL Database:** A fully managed, production-ready PostgreSQL database supporting complex queries and strong data integrity.
  • 2**Authentication:** Built-in user management with support for email/password, OAuth providers (e.g., Google, GitHub), multi-factor authentication (MFA), and phone OTP, leveraging PostgreSQL's Row-Level Security (RLS).
  • 3**Instant APIs:** Automatically generates RESTful and GraphQL APIs directly from the database schema, streamlining data access.
  • 4**Realtime Subscriptions:** Enables real-time data synchronization via WebSockets, facilitating live features like chat and collaborative tools.
  • 5**Storage:** A secure and scalable object storage solution for managing files such as images and documents, with access controls integrated with RLS.
  • 6**Edge Functions:** Serverless functions written in TypeScript/JavaScript (using Deno runtime) deployed globally for low-latency custom backend logic.
  • 7**pgvector for Embeddings:** Native support for the `pgvector` PostgreSQL extension, enabling storage and querying of high-dimensional vector data for AI and machine learning applications.

use cases

Who Should Use Supabase?

Supabase is designed for developers, startups, and companies seeking a comprehensive, scalable, and open-source backend solution for various application types.

  • 1**Developers:** Building web and mobile applications that require real-time features, secure authentication, and a robust relational database.
  • 2**Startups and SaaS Platforms:** Requiring rapid backend deployment, scalable infrastructure, and role-based access control for their services.
  • 3**AI and LLM-powered Applications:** Leveraging `pgvector` support for semantic search, RAG systems, and other machine learning functionalities.
  • 4**Data-Intensive Projects:** Such as analytics dashboards and internal tools that benefit from PostgreSQL's capabilities and integrated backend services.

pricing

Supabase Pricing & Plans

Supabase operates on a freemium model, offering a free tier with limited resources suitable for small projects and experimentation. Paid plans, including Pro, Team, and Enterprise, provide increased resources, dedicated support, and enhanced backup retention policies. The Pro plan, starting at $25 per month, includes 7 days of daily backups. Team plan projects offer 14 days of backups, and Enterprise plan projects retain up to 30 days of backups. Business Associate Agreements (BAA) are available upon request for Team and Enterprise customers, supporting HIPAA alignment.

  • 1**Free Plan:** Limited resources, suitable for personal projects and testing, projects paused after one week of inactivity.
  • 2**Pro Plan:** Starts at $25/month, includes increased compute, storage, and 7 days of daily backups.
  • 3**Team Plan:** Custom pricing, designed for collaborative teams, includes 14 days of daily backups and BAA availability.
  • 4**Enterprise Plan:** Custom pricing, tailored for large organizations, offers up to 30 days of daily backups and BAA availability.

competitors

Supabase vs Competitors

Supabase differentiates itself within the backend-as-a-service market by offering an open-source, PostgreSQL-centric approach compared to various alternatives.

1
Appwrite

Appwrite is an open-source, self-hosted backend-as-a-service platform that provides core APIs for web, mobile, and Flutter developers.

Like Supabase, Appwrite offers a comprehensive suite of backend services including database, authentication, storage, and functions. However, Appwrite emphasizes self-hosting with Docker and offers a different underlying database approach (MariaDB/Postgres/Mongo via adapters), while Supabase is built on PostgreSQL.

2
Nhost

Nhost is an open-source GraphQL backend that combines PostgreSQL, Hasura, and serverless functions to provide a GraphQL-native developer experience.

Nhost is very similar to Supabase in its open-source, PostgreSQL-centric approach and 'Firebase alternative' positioning. The key difference lies in Nhost's strong GraphQL-first focus via Hasura, whereas Supabase primarily offers REST and its own client libraries, though it also has a GraphQL API.

3
Firebase (Google Firebase)

Firebase is Google's comprehensive mobile and web application development platform, offering a wide range of integrated backend services with a strong focus on real-time capabilities and a NoSQL database.

Supabase is explicitly an 'open-source Firebase alternative.' Firebase provides a broader ecosystem of tools and primarily uses NoSQL databases (Firestore and Realtime Database), while Supabase offers an open-source, PostgreSQL-based SQL approach.

4
AWS Amplify

AWS Amplify is a set of tools and services from Amazon Web Services designed to simplify building scalable full-stack applications, deeply integrated with the AWS ecosystem.

While not open-source in the same way as Supabase's core, Amplify provides a similar developer experience for building backends with features like authentication, data, and storage. However, it is tightly coupled with AWS services and infrastructure, often defaulting to DynamoDB (NoSQL) for data, unlike Supabase's PostgreSQL focus.

Frequently Asked Questions

+What is Supabase?

Supabase is a backend-as-a-service (BaaS) platform developed by Supabase that enables developers, startups, and companies to build web, mobile, and AI applications rapidly. It provides a comprehensive suite of open-source tools including a PostgreSQL database, authentication, file storage, and real-time capabilities.

+Is Supabase free?

Yes, Supabase offers a free tier with limited resources suitable for small projects and experimentation. Additionally, it provides paid plans (Pro, Team, Enterprise) starting from $25 per month for the Pro plan, which offer increased resources, dedicated support, and enhanced backup retention policies.

+What are the main features of Supabase?

The main features of Supabase include a fully managed PostgreSQL database, robust user authentication and authorization, instant RESTful and GraphQL APIs, real-time data synchronization via WebSockets, secure file storage, globally deployed Edge Functions (serverless logic), and native support for `pgvector` for AI embeddings.

+Who should use Supabase?

Supabase is ideal for developers, startups, and companies building web, mobile, and AI applications that require a scalable, open-source backend. It is particularly well-suited for projects needing a PostgreSQL database, real-time features, secure authentication, and support for vector embeddings in AI applications.

+How does Supabase compare to alternatives?

Supabase distinguishes itself as an open-source Firebase alternative built on PostgreSQL, offering a relational database approach unlike Firebase's NoSQL focus. Compared to Appwrite, Supabase provides a managed service built on Postgres, while Appwrite emphasizes self-hosting. Against Nhost, Supabase offers a broader API approach (REST/GraphQL), whereas Nhost is primarily GraphQL-first via Hasura. Unlike AWS Amplify, Supabase provides an open-source, PostgreSQL-centric backend, while Amplify is deeply integrated with the AWS ecosystem and often uses DynamoDB.

For builders

This page is doing a job for someone else’s tool.

AI agents read it. Buyers find it. Backlinks accrue. Your tool can have one too — live in 24 hours, indexed by Claude, ChatGPT, and Perplexity, queryable via MCP.